It's been a while since I've posted here. For the last 3 years I've been repairing all of my guitars that were damaged in the 2016 floods in Louisiana. Except for a few small things here & there I'm finally done with the major repair jobs. Now I'm moving back to some new projects. I completed this one a few weeks ago. It's not a complete new build but it was a major overhaul of the guitar.
This one started out as a weird Iceman/Explorer/Tele hybrid made of solid purpleheart. The front had the shape of an Iceman, the back was the Explorer and it had the controls & pickups of a Telecaster. Oh yeah... and it had a Bigsby trem. I honestly don't know what I was thinking at the time. On top of it being weird looking, being a large body made of purpleheart it was a beast. I don't remember the exact weight but it was over 15 lbs.
I reworked the shape of the body where it resembled more of the Paul Gilbert Iceman/Destroyer hybrid. I hollowed it out to remove all that weight, put on a douglas fir top and stained it a redish-purple to match the natural purpleheart. I reworked the pickup config to be 3 humbuckers with individual on/off switches and a tone & volume knob. The pickups are some Ibanez V-5's I had in the parts box & the bridge is a Schaller roller bridge. Neck is dyed maple to match the body & rosewood fingerboard. Don't let the inlay's fool you, they are just some vinyl inlay decals.
Overall it's a major improvement from where it started. The weight isn't too bad in the 7 lb range and it plays and sounds really well. For now I only have one pic but I'll post more when I get a chance to take some more.
